About Ben

Ben is an affectionate cat who seeks a calm and loving home. He was surrendered along with his brother, Peabody, when their owners could no longer care for them. While his paperwork suggests he's 2-3 years old, his teeth hint that he might be a bit older. He enjoys lounging around, eating, and occasionally chatting for attention. Ben tends to be shy, often hiding when he feels overwhelmed, so a laidback household would be ideal for him. If you're ready for a gentle companion who loves to cuddle, Ben is waiting to meet you.
